three-stage audio amplifier EM1 power filter

Input voltage: single-phase AC 110--250V

Output voltage: single-phase AC 110--250V

Load rated current: 4A--20A

Input port: three-wire 7.62 socket input

Output port: 2-wire 7.62 socket output

Three-stage composite (1-stage differential mode + 2-stage common mode) EM1 EMI filter circuit, due to the use of three-stage (also known as three-section) filtering, so the filtering of noise is more effective.

For some user sites there is a repetition frequency of several kilohertz of fast transient group pulse interference, can play a suppression role.

This module with decoder use or amplifier use, can filter the power DC component, eliminate and suppress transformer hum, high-frequency noise in the power supply, purify the power supply, can Significantly improve the sound quality of the amplifier, enhance the resolution and make the background quiet. The input GND needs to be connected to the ground of the power line, but also can be connected to the chassis shell again, depending on the circumstances.
